Weight of a body on the surfaces of two planets is the same. If their densities are `d_(1) and d_(2)`, then ratio of their radii is

A

`d_(1)//d_(2)`

B

`d_(2)//d_(1)`

C

`d_(1)^(2)//d_(2)^(2)`

D

`d_(2)^(2)//d_(2)^(2)`

Text Solution

Verified by Experts

The correct Answer is:
b

`W_(1)=W_(2)`
`mg_(1)=mg_(2)`
`(GM_(1))/(R_(1)^(2))=(GM_(2))/(R_(2)^(2))`
`(Gd_(1)(4pi)/(3)R_(1)^(3))/(R_(1)^(2))=(Gd_(2)(4pi)/(3)R_(2)^(3))/(R_(2)^(2))`
`d_(1)R_(1)^(1)=d_(2)R_(2)^(2)`
`(d_(1))/(d_(2))=(R_(2))/(R_(1))`
